Tried some searching but couldnt find solid info. Flying overseas soon, whats the scoop on laptops on airplanes? Can you use them? Are there plugins for power? Can you tell I never fly :D
|
laptops are ok. Power depends on the plane. Some have outlets at the seat some do not. You might try calling the airline and asking what they offer. Also, there should be outlets in the lav that you can plug into for a short time.
